Transaction 51158815898a879b79361e98f4587882e83800a1ba6db0d5fee9bcb2f426b99f
1 Input
1 Output
-
51158815898a879b79361e98f4587882e83800a1ba6db0d5fee9bcb2f426b99f:0
- value
- 21102334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db28ef540f60d05d75947e6c5032dbede976a150 OP_EQUAL
- address
- 3Mfpwm1rQa4AyVDszRQaVPz42iw7znRC7Z